FOOTBALL'S golden boy David Beckham has told of the heartbreaking moment he was "spat on" while becoming the "most hated person in the country".<\/p>\n
His career low came after the ex-Manchester United footballer was dealt a red card in the 1998 World Cup while representing England.<\/p>\n
\n
\n<\/p>\n
Becks, 48,\u00a0told his new Netflix documentary of his torment after being sent off – which many fans at the time believed cost the nation the trophy.<\/p>\n
He was sent to the stands after a ill-timed tackle on Argentina\u2019s\u00a0Diego Simeone.<\/p>\n
David \u2014 who was just 23 at the time \u2014 reflected on it as the hardest time of his professional and personal life.<\/p>\n
He said in his new TV show: \u201cWhat I went through was so extreme. The whole country hated me. Hated me.<\/p>\n
\u201cIt changed my life. I felt very vulnerable and alone. Wherever I went I got abuse every single day.<\/p>\n \u201cPeople look at you in a certain way, spit at you, abuse you, come up to your face and say some of the things that they said. That was difficult.\u201d<\/p>\n The red card in the last 16 game against Argentina in 1998 was blamed for ten-man\u00a0England\u00a0losing on penalties.<\/p>\n For the next two years Becks was booed in stadiums across the country, and an effigy of him was even hung outside a South London pub.<\/p>\n <\/span><\/p>\n <\/span><\/p>\n <\/span><\/p>\n <\/span><\/p>\n Beckham was left clinically depressed by the hate he received after being sent off in the crunch\u00a0World Cup\u00a0match, his wife\u00a0Victoria\u00a0has also revealed.<\/p>\n The superstar pair recalled their pain in a four-part series called Beckham.<\/p>\n In tough scenes, Victoria said: \u201cI mean, the absolute hate, the public bullying, to another level.<\/p>\n \u201cHe was depressed, absolutely clinically depressed.<\/p>\n \u201cI still want to kill these people.\u201d<\/p>\n The documentary also showcases the moment David knew he fancied now-wife Victoria.<\/p>\n He previously met the Spice Girl in car parks when they first started dating.<\/p>\n David has drummed up the anticipation for the documentary and told how it will feature "many stories I've never told".<\/p>\n The series, to be released on October 4, explores some of Golden Balls' most iconic on and off-pitch moments.<\/p>\n<\/picture>doting dad <\/span><\/p>\n
